Bestof

Classification Of Operating System

Classification Of Operating System

Understanding the fundamental construction of reckon environments command a deep dive into the Classification Of Operating Scheme architectures. An operating scheme serves as the keystone of every digital device, behave as an intermediary between ironware and exploiter covering. By organizing software resources, deal remembering, and coordinating peripheral devices, these system specify how efficaciously a estimator performs its tasks. Whether you are apply a smartphone, a high-performance waiter, or an embedded scheme in a vehicle, the underlying OS character determines the scheme's reactivity, security, and overall capability. Because engineering continues to germinate apace, staying informed about these distinguishable eccentric is essential for developer, IT professionals, and enthusiast alike.

Understanding OS Categorization

Operating system are not one- sizing -fits-all solutions. They are specifically designed to address different computing needs, ranging from single-task management to complex, multi-user environments. To better understand the Classification Of Operating Scheme, we must look at how they handle processes, memory, and hardware interaction.

Batch Operating Systems

Batch processing was among the earliest method of compute. In this setup, users do not interact directly with the computer. Instead, jobs are assemble into "batches" and posit to a calculator operator who then process them sequentially. This method is extremely efficient for orotund, repetitious chore that do not command constant user stimulus.

  • Efficiency: Reduces unfounded time for the cpu.
  • Application: Payroll systems, bank statement, and large-scale information processing.
  • Drawback: Lack of interactivity; if a job fails, the whole batch can be delay.

Time-Sharing Operating Systems

Time-sharing grant multiple user to percentage the computer's resource simultaneously. The OS apportion a specific clip slice to each exploiter, switching between them so quick that each exploiter perceives they have dedicated admission to the machine. This is the foot of modern multi-user calculation.

Distributed Operating Systems

These systems manage a solicitation of sovereign computers and make them appear to the exploiter as a single, unified system. They are interconnected via communicating net, allow for freight balancing and increased dependability.

Comparative Overview of OS Types

The postdate table exemplify the nucleus differences between primary operate system architectures to help see the Assortment Of Operating Scheme landscape:

System Type Master Goal User Interaction
Clutch OS Eminent Throughput Low / None
Time-Sharing OS Response Clip High (Multi-user)
Real -Time OS Determinism/Speed Varies
Distributed OS Resource Partake Remote/Networked

💡 Tone: Always ensure the underlie ironware architecture is compatible with the OS core to obviate performance bottleneck or compatibility failures.

Real-Time and Networked Systems

Real-Time Go Systems (RTOS) are critical for environment where timing is non-negotiable. If a response is not deliver within a rigorously delineate clip bod, the system is consider to have miscarry. Common in medical equipment, flying control systems, and industrial robotics, these systems prioritize dependability and contiguous execution over general-purpose utility.

Network Operating Systems

A Network Operating System (NOS) is specifically designed to back workstations, personal estimator, and, in some instances, old terminals that are connected on a local area network (LAN). The package scat on the host furnish the capacity to manage information, user, grouping, protection, application, and other networking mapping.

The Evolution of Modern Systems

Mod operating systems are oftentimes "intercrossed" in nature. For instance, today's mobile run systems share trait of both time-sharing and real-time systems, as they must respond to user stimulation instantly while manage ground datum chore. Read the Classification Of Operating Scheme categories helps in choose the correct tool for specific computational challenges, ensuring that package efficiency match hardware possible.

Frequently Asked Questions

Batch OS processes jobs in radical without unmediated user interaction, whereas Time-Sharing OS grant multiple users to interact with the system simultaneously through speedy CPU shift.
A Real-Time Operating System check that datum treat happens within a strict, predictable clip frame, which is essential for safety-critical tasks like robotics and aviation.
A Distributed OS manages multiple autonomous computer nodes, coordinating them through a meshing so that they behave like a individual, co-ordinated calculate unit to the end user.

The landscape of computing relies heavily on how we organize and manage resources through different package frameworks. By categorise these system based on their processing logic, user interaction models, and environment requirements, we profit a clearer picture of how technology maintains performance across diverse ironware. Whether contend mere machine-controlled tasks or complex global network, the continue study of these architectures remain critical for technical progress and the on-going advance of the digital infrastructure that supports modern life.

Related Terms:

  • departure between all operating system
  • two types of operating scheme
  • types of operating system notes
  • assorted case of operating scheme
  • representative of computer operating systems
  • representative of different control scheme